Screen patients with suspected liver cancer Long-term exposure to liver cancer risk factors (hepatitis B carriers, past history of schistosomiasis, long-term diet of Aspergillus food, history of liver cirrhosis, etc.), patients with liver cancer are initially suspected.\n2. Monitor the number of CTCs in the blood of patients with liver cancer before and after surgery Imaging examinations show that liver space is occupied by patients with suspected liver cancer. Use CTCBIOPSY® technology to monitor patients' surgical operations (including interventional therapy, tumor resection, or liver cancer liver transplantation) at different times 1-3 days before, 1 month after surgery, and 6 months after surgery The number of CTCs in peripheral blood.\n3.
